
All About Cotton is one of many crochet books by Leisure Arts. If you’re a big cotton yarn fan like me, then you’ll love this book. It has 10 crochet projects for the home, kitchen, and bath to include cotton baskets, a water bottle carrier, tote bag, potholder, plant hangar, spa set, rug, dishcloth, placemats, and coasters. Cotton yarn is durable and soft. It’s perfect for projects around the home.

The oval baskets are perfect for the bathroom and for organizing and storing craft supplies. I like them for small balls of yarn, hair accessories, chip clips.
The bottle carrier is great for hikes or just to carry with you on a hot day. The lacy tote, one of my favorites, is just the right size for a quick trip to the store. I also made this with color-coordinated yarn my mother gave me from her stash. It worked up quickly. The picot stitch makes for a perfect design.
The air plant hangar is a unique decor piece that holds small succulents.

Another favorite of mine is the bath set. I made the face cloth, scrubby, and bath pouf in pink and white for my granddaughter. The coasters are colorful and come with a pattern for a matching holder.
I particularly liked the stitch pattern used in the dishcloth and towel set. I made these, too, using the same color yarn as shown in the book.
The potholder and placemat are next on my to-do list. I have bright-colored summery yarn that I’d like to use for these projects. The half hexagon rug is a splendid accent piece for any room. It fits nicely against the wall.

The book is well organized. It contains a section on general instructions and yarn information for the projects included in the book. Almost all patterns use a size H crochet hook (the rug uses a J) and worsted weight cotton yarn (4). The crochet patterns are easy to read and follow. Another good thing about the book is that it’s available both in print and digital formats. I use both, but I do like having patterns available on my cell when I’m on the road.
